SEASON 6 - MAJOR SPOILERS + Definitely Dead Spoilers
A new love interest that has been talked about is Ben (a highly charismatic faerie who takes a liking to Sookie (and vice-versa) and helps Sookie and Jason delve deeper into the mystery of their parents’ murders. He’s magnetic to women and men folk alike, all while using his Southern gentility to mask a dark, dark, dark side.) He will be played by Rob Kazinsky. He sounds a bit like a combo of Claude(from books) and John Quinn(were-tiger). In the recently released audition tapes, character Ben has apparently been in prison. He helps Sookie, and then he threatens her. They read each others minds (which is not featured in the tapes), but it sounds like Sookie is planning to visit her science teacher (?).
We last saw Debbie’s parents trying to find out where Debbie’s gone in season 5, so the probability of this also happening on the show is highly likely. Eric is the one who rescues them both in the book.
Judging from what happened at the end of season 5, that war will be humans against vampires. This is also reinforced by the fact that the new villain will be Creighton Burrell(Arliss Howard), the Governor of Louisiana. He has a major hate-on for fangers, owing to the fact that his wife ditched him with their daughter to be with one. His daughter’s name is Willa, 22,(Amelia Rose Blaire). While her position is against her fathers plans she is powerless to stop him from his. She has long clashed with her father over vampire rights. From audition tapes, there is a scene when Steve Newlin visit’s the governor to negotiate peace between vampires and humans. He’s violating vampire rights and Newlin wants an official apology. Now the way in which governor Burrell is doing that, is by torturing vampires in special prisons. This is supported by casting calls, calling for Louisiana Anti-Vampire Task Force, a beautiful Thai woman who is used to get vampires to participate in therapy named Somchai, LAVTF team commander, security chief, Finn who is a middle-aged prison psychiatrist.
Other info on the governor of Louisiana: a casting call for Connor Farley, about 45 and works for the Department of Wildlife, who is on his way to a meeting with the governor, he finds himself in a problematic situation. So this governor will be pretty evil. He will also have an evil advisor - Dr. Overlark,. He’s a ruthless 50-year-old. All of this stuff seems to be related to Eric’s storyline, judging from the paparazzi photos.

Season 5 ended with Luna shifting live on TV. This will probably cause some kind of outing of shifters and weres, or at least start it. In the later books, shifters and weres do come out to the public. Someone who seems to take part in this is a human girl Nicole, a “do-gooder to the core. Nicole is naive, optimistic, and charming — but her idealism is “ultimately vaguely idiotic and dangerous.” Key member of a band of well-meaning liberal advocates. The gang models itself after the civil rights activist Freedom Riders of the 1960s, a group of progressive protesters who rode buses from state to state, challenging racial segregation and Jim Crow travel laws. The Freedom Riders were usually arrested, and fell victim to mob violence, Ku Klux Klan beatings, and cruel and unusual punishment in prison. Don’t expect a secret agenda from Nicole, “A true bleeding heart,” Nicole is “not at all concerned with money; she’s concerned with the common good and doing what’s right … Life hasn’t beaten her down yet.” If you’re still not getting a clear picture, the casting call suggests that she went to Bryn Mawr College and drives an old Saab. Jurnee Smollett will play her. This character will be trying to talk Sam into joining her cause, along with other shifters. Rutger Hauer (Blade Runner) is joining the show as Macklyn Warlow/Niall. There will also be Warlow’s flashback, as Niall’s protective mother appears in 3500B.C., so he’s almost 6000 years old, there will be a young him as well. There are pictures of Warlow and Jason on the set, during the day. As we know from season 5, Warlow killed Sookie’s parents and has a contract which says that Sookie belongs to him. All the confusion on how he can be Niall as well, aside, the only way Sookie could come out of being sold to a vampire is probably by marrying another one. In All Together Dead, Sookie gets tricked by Eric into marrying him, this way he protected her from being used by Sophie-Anne and other vampire royalty. It is a strong possibility that this Warlow was introduced, so that this bit can happen.
